HTML5 - Работа с шрифтове - Част 1

Съдържание
Един от основните аспекти при работа с текст в HTML са промените в изображението, които могат да настъпят само чрез промяна на шрифта на буквите, но има два аспекта на професионалистите, които работят във връзка с това, дизайнерите, които искат да променят всеки аспект на типографията, и програмистите, които въпреки че искат да когато работят с тях, те не искат да правят толкова дълбоки промени по този въпрос.
Свойства на шрифта
Преди да започнем работа с източниците, ще направим преглед на техните свойства, за да знаем предисторията на това:
  • шрифтово семейство: Указва семейството на шрифтовете за блок текст.
  • размер на шрифта: Определя размера на шрифта за блок текст.
  • стил на шрифта: Определя стила на шрифта, той може да бъде нормален, курсив, наклонен.
  • font-variant: Определя дали текстът на блока може да се показва с шрифт smallcaps, възможните му стойности са smallcaps и normal.
  • тегло на шрифта: Определя теглото на шрифта за текстов блок, тоест дебелината му, стойностите му могат да бъдат нормални, удебелени, по -смели, по -светли.
  • шрифт: Пряк път, който ви позволява да посочите шрифта в един ред.
Избор на източник
Собствеността шрифтово семейство Определяме групата шрифтове, които ще се използват, като установяваме ред на предпочитания, така че ако някой не е наличен, той се предава към следващия по ред на предпочитания. Браузърът започва с първия шрифт в списъка и продължава да се опитва за всеки от шрифтовете в установения ред, докато има такъв, който може да използва.
Това се случва, защото може да се наложи да използваме шрифтове, инсталирани на компютъра на потребителя или принадлежащи към конкретна операционна система, така че ако друг потребител не отговаря на изискванията, ние можем да контролираме как това ще повлияе на нашия документ.
И накрая, нека видим списък с общи шрифтове, които трябва да бъдат достъпни по стандартен начин за всички системи и с които не би трябвало да имаме проблеми.
  • засечка
  • без засечки
  • курсив
  • фантазия
  • монопространство
Много добре, тъй като обхванахме теоретичния аспект на това как е боравенето с източници, нека видим примери с код, от който ще получим нашите знания как да приложим на практика всичко, което сме изучавали:
 Пример

Има много различни видове плодове - има само над 500 сорта банани. Докато добавим безбройните видове ябълки, портокали и други добре познати плодове, ние сме изправени пред хиляди възможности за избор.


В този код виждаме, че в семейството на шрифтовете е дефиниран нетрадиционен шрифт, тъй като той е патентован шрифт HelveticaNeue Condensed и след това като второ предпочитание поставяме монопространство Нека да видим как можем да видим това в браузъра за всеки от дефинираните случаи.
[attachment = 861: html5fuentes.jpg.webp]
Вляво на изображението имаме случая, в който шрифтът, който е поставен като първи избор, не съществува, тоест шрифтът монопространство, от дясната страна виждаме собствения шрифт.
С това завършваме урока, след като познахме теоретичните основи и ги приложихме на практика, сега сме в състояние да си поиграем малко с източниците на нашето приложение и да постигнем по -привлекателни визуално резултати и в съответствие с това, което искаме.
Можете да продължите да четете част 2 от този урок.Хареса ли ви и помогнахте на този урок?Можете да възнаградите автора, като натиснете този бутон, за да му дадете положителна точка
wave wave wave wave wave